Very stupidly have managed to align passport renewal date with the run-up to a major birthday. Was feeling OK about the birthday until I breezed into a Photo Me booth at the weekend. It spat out a set of images that made me look like Madge Allsop, Dame Edna's former bridesmaid.

Bit of a shocker and not really something to put anyone in a holiday mood. So today, in search of better set, I have visited a high street photographers twice, they were closed both times, and three supermarkets, one with an out of order booth, and one with a booth which I thought had produced a marginally better result until I got home and noticed hair in my eyes. In a final bid for a more flattering result I returned to the original supermarket with a cardboard box covered in tin foil which I held under my face. It works! The results are much improved (but wish I hadn't done this where we do the weekly shop as the security and welcome desk staff clearly think I'm nuts).
